"It's a balanced class, not necessarily for beginners
alone, but with lots of options because yoga can be very
gentle, mindful, yet strenuous," Burns said. "But it's a
great workout and it's fun to have different instructors
lead each portion."
Achieving an inner quiet is the main function of yoga,
but how is it possible amid a crowd of hundreds in a
public place? Burns said it's easy when you recognize that
everyone has come with the same intention.
"Very few people arrive with the intent to impress
others," she said.
Instead, it's a time to let go, let your limbs stretch and
explore, and allow your mind to befriend your body.
"The session is our contribution to National Yoga Day,"
Burns said. "It's our way to celebrate with the community
and help people share the practice with others. I
encourage anyone with an interest to try it. Everyone can
partake and be successful."
Burns hopes people will leave with an understanding
of how yoga affects movement outside of a class -
because yoga extends beyond the mat.
"It becomes more than mental and physical exercise,"
Burns said. "It teaches us how to properly move through
everyday life; we're training the muscles of the body to
support better alignment. Our hips, knees and toes learn
to turn in the right direction. And best of all, we find we
are able to invite new possibilities, achieve new things and
give ourselves the grace to challenge our fears."
Village of Charlotte resident Karen Beatty has been
practicing yoga for a decade. After her husband, Phil's,
heart surgery a year ago, she got him to join. Beginning
first with chair yoga, he worked up to a more vigorous
flow. The two take classes several times per week now,
including Burns' Centergy classes, along with other types
of exercise.
"Yoga keeps me limber," Beatty said. "And the older I
get, the better it is."
Burns said Centergy is faster-paced than the session
on the square. Set to upbeat music, it offers an aerobic
component.

"I've seen some wonderful things happen as a result
of the class," Burns said. "People who spent all their lives
exercising and being really intense find they can actually
enjoy exercise, be happy without the exhaustion. On the
flip side, those who have never exercised can get into it,
get comfortable with it and find they are willing to test
themselves. That confidence leads to other things."
As Burns gears up for the annual yoga soiree on the
square, she offers advice to those who can't wait to get
started. Ease into it with hatha, a light, yet invigorating
style of yoga that is not meticulously focused on
precision and alignment. And for those who want a
more dynamic flow, ashtanga may be the right fit. The
physically demanding practice offers longer holds, more
structure and emphasis on perfecting each posture.
Those who attend the yoga class at the square will
experience both styles.
